What should be preference order of IMT Ghaziabad courses- PGDM, PGDM marketing, PGDM finance, PGDM DCP, PGDM banking, insurance and financial services?

DC
Dhruv Chatterjee Posted On : January 25th, 2023
PGDM from Institute of Management Technology, Ghaziabad (Graduated 2022)

IMT Ghaziabad offers a variety of courses that cater to various specializations. These courses have been listed and explained in their order of preference

  • PGDM Marketing/PGDM Full Time (Marketing): This is the most coveted program among IMT students mainly because today its alumni have acquired top positions in big firms. Other major reasons include top-notch faculty, great internship and placement opportunities in terms of role and CTC, IMT’s eligibility, and excellent performances in recognized marketing and strategy B Schools competitions.
  • PGDM Finance/PGDM Full Time (Finance): This one is most suitable for aspirants who are interested in Finance. However, this program offers lesser opportunities than the Marketing program in terms of role and CTC. 
  • PGDM Full Time (Operations): This program offers opportunities similar to that of Finance. But the batch size of PGDM Operations is smaller than PGDM Finance, so it may be easier to secure an internship/final placement, but the opportunities come less compared to Finance.
  • PGDM DCP: DCP or the Dual Country Program is for those who are keen to get international exposure. Compared to an MBA from a foreign university, this program is cheaper and yet offers an opportunity to explore a different culture and learn to make decisions in an international context. This is best suitable for those who are in the Marketing domain.
  • PGDM Banking and Financial Services (PGDM-BFS): This program was launched in 2019 and is relatively newer. It targets the core Banking and Finance sector. While the MBA program aims to provide a holistic view of management, this program solely focuses on Banking and Finance.
  • PGDM Full Time (HR): This is the least taken course and offers very less in terms of opportunities.

The courses have been arranged preference-wise so will make it easy for you to choose one.

In NITIE, which programme is a better choice among PGDMM and PGDPM?

AS
Atul Sharma Posted On : August 18th, 2021
PGDPM from National Institute of Industrial Engineering (2018)

One of my friends is studying at NITIE, and as per his insights, both the programs are excellent. The final choice depends upon the area of your interest. Consider the following points before making the final choice.

  • PGDPM concentrates on teaching project management along with functional areas like Finance, HR, and others. It is a strategic level course that creates professionals for every sector or industry.
  • PGDMM is a course focusing on the manufacturing and operational part of a business. It builds skilled professional that is well-equipped with the latest technologies.
  • As per the past placement statistics, the average package for PGDPM is INR 11.5 LPA, and for PGDMM is INR 10.8 LPA.

Apart from the above points, detailed information about the two programs is available on the institute webpage. You can compare the programs and make your final choice. Overall, the scope of both programs is high.

Which University is good for a distance MBA in operation management Suresh Gyan Vihar University or ICFAI University Tripura why?

TS
Taranjeet Singh Posted On : November 20th, 2020
Studied at ICFAI University

Suresh Gyan Vihar University offers a distance MBA degree in Operations and Production Management across four semesters. ICFAI Tripura University offers a general MBA program with a specialization in Marketing, Finance, and HR Management, Operations, etc.

Let us take a look at what the two programs have to offer in detail.

Admissions:

The admission details for the courses are as follows.

Particulars

Suresh Gyan Vihar University

ICFAI Tripura University

Eligibility

Minimum 50% score in graduation from any field

Minimum 45% score in graduation

Work Experience

Less than 50% score requires 2 years of work experience

Not required

Fees

INR 98,947

INR 60,000

Course structure:

Suresh Gyan Vihar University:

  • The course curriculum is well-organized and spread across 4 semesters with foundation and practical level subjects in operations management like business policies, supply chain management, Inventory management, and global logistics.

  • The structure has been designed in such a way to build real-world skills and analytical thinking across wide sectors.

ICFAI University Tripura:

  • The degree offers a total of 20 courses with a wide range of elective subjects to choose from across Marketing, Human Resource, Finance, Operations, etc.

  • Students must mandatorily complete a semester internship and submit one management thesis at the end of the program.

  • The curriculum also includes practical subjects in developing soft skills, confidence-building programs, and mock interview training sessions.

  • Students also have the option of choosing more than one elective subject in a given semester.

Highlights:

  • Suresh Gyan Vihar offers an extra module in Business Communication and a mandatory Project submission at the end of the semester to help students have a clear concept regarding all subjects.

  • ICFAI University Tripura offers an extra-departmental skill enhancement course at the end of every semester which is designed to help students across various areas of their personalities be it in group discussions, body language training, public speaking, and much more.

Faculty:

While both the institutions have well-trained highly academic faculty members, if you are looking for a program in Operations management, Suresh Gyan Vihar has faculty members who have specifically specialized in that field of study.

Placements:

The institutes do not offer direct placements for distance MBA degrees but ICFAI University Tripura has an online career services department that offers students help and guidance regarding job and internship related opportunities. Students can contact the online cell to get relevant information regarding placements.

Based on the given pointers, students can make an informed choice regarding a distance MBA program in Operations management.
